The tour begins at the Amerling fountain outside the old town walls, near Dubravka restaurant. Guests are picked up here for the panoramic drive and returned to this same point after.
The group travels by vehicle to the peak of Mt Srdj, standing at 415 meters (approximately 1,200 feet). From this vantage point, the full sweep of Dubrovnik's old town, islands, and coastline comes into view as evening light settles across the Adriatic.
Returning to street level, the walking portion begins at the Pile Gate, the western entrance to the old city. The guide leads the group along the Stradun, explaining its history as the civic and commercial spine of the Republic of Ragusa.
The route continues to Luza Square, where the Rector's Palace and Dubrovnik Cathedral stand as the twin pillars of Ragusan institutional life. The guide provides context on the political and religious history embedded in each structure.
A stop at the monument of poet Ivan Gundulic offers a cultural counterpoint to the political landmarks. The tour then moves through Prijeko Street, one of the old town's most atmospheric lanes.
The tour concludes back at the Amerling fountain, where guests are dropped off. Those who wish to continue exploring the old town on their own are well-positioned to do so from this central location.
